С Хромом:
транслировать весь рабочий стол + звук не очень понятно. (Означает ли это зеркалирование? Или просто получить доступ к файлам, как с помощью файлового менеджера? Кажется, вы пробовали это с Chrome, но Chrome не воспроизводит файлы со звуком.)
Chrome может просматривать папки и файлы (открывать в нем папку). С помощью Ctrl-O он может выбирать файлы для открытия. Аудиофайлы и некоторые видеофайлы (mp4) можно воспроизводить в Chrome и транслировать.
Возможно, доступ к папкам с помощью Chrome и кастинг что является решением.
(Странно, в какой-то момент в Хроме на ПК не было звука для локальных файлов, но был при кастинге на ТВ. Это может быть решением предложенной Вами проблемы, что в Хроме нет звука для локальных аудиофайлов , При полном отключении от устройств Chromecast - после перезапуска - Chrome также смог воспроизводить звук на ноутбуке.)
Без Хрома:
Для трансляции видео или аудио файлов проще всего использовать VLC. При подключении ПК к той же сети (Wi-Fi) ваше устройство Chromecasting должно появиться в VLC под Воспроизведение — визуализатор. (Из одного из комментариев вы, кажется, ищете только аудио? VLC делает это.)

Для всего рабочего стола решение Gnome, доступное на Flathub,
Сетевые дисплеи GNOME. (Не могу подтвердить, что это сработает, я в Kubuntu.)